Inline frame instead of page include when using "close topmost" sliding panel

edited June 28 in Ideas
Just wanted to point out a work around to an issue I encountered. I have a page and in that page is a sliding panel. In that sliding panel is a page include. That included page also has sliding panels. 
When you us the action "Close Top most" sliding panel in the page included page, it closes the topmost panel in the page included page and the parent page. to avoid this, instead of doing a page include, use a template component and do an inline frame.

<IFRAME SRC="/apex/skuid__ui?page=YOURSKUIDPAGENAMEHERE&id={{{Id}}}"  WIDTH=100% HEIGHT=800px>


1
1 votes

Implemented · Last Updated

Comments

  • Anna WiersemaAnna Wiersema Skuid Mod, Admin 🛠️ 
    edited June 18
    Thanks for sharing, Raymond!
  • Emily DavisEmily Davis Skuad ✭✭
    edited June 24
    Hi, Raymond,
    Just checking in here, did the issue with Sliding Panels present itself in a v1 or v2 page for you? I'm doing a bit of investigation to see if we need to make an update to the product in this regard. It sounds like it's a v1 page, given that you used a Template component for your workaround?
    Thanks!
    Emily
  • edited June 24
    It was version 1, but I can’t find the example now
  • edited June 29
    I FOUND IT!
    I thought I was losing my mind because I couldn't replicate the problem after I was sure there was a problem. The issue is when you open a slider using Push (I used Top, not sure if that matters), then when you close top most in a page include, it closes the sliding panel on the parent page. If you set it to overlay, the problem does not happen. 
  • edited June 29
    The same issue happens when you use "Reveal". 
  • Anna WiersemaAnna Wiersema Skuid Mod, Admin 🛠️ 

    @Skuidward Tentacles (Raymond) Can you remind me what Skuid version you're using?

    • If you upgrade in sandbox to the latest version of Skuid, does the issue persist?
    • It would expedite the investigation of this issue if you could provide a simplified version of these pages according to these instructions. That way we can easily transport them into one of our orgs.

    Thanks!

  • 12.4.6

    ill Try to get you the rest of your request later this weekend. Thanks!

Sign In or Register to comment.